A slight redesign to improve strength; and an interesting technique I’ve not seen used elsewhere. The original design was weak because the assembly holding up the warp drive would easily pop off the technic beams running through the wing. I’ve now added a white rubber band which is stretched very tight and basically keeps the two parts pressed together. Not sure if this is a “legal” technique (even if it’s a legit LEGO rubber band).
